What is the structure of an argumentative essay?

Back

An argumentative essay typically consists of an introduction, body paragraphs, and a conclusion.

What is the purpose of the introduction in argumentative writing?

Back

The introduction acquaints the reader with the topic and presents the thesis statement.

What is a thesis statement?

Back

A thesis statement is a clear and concise statement that presents the main argument or position of the writer.

What is a controversial topic?

Back

A controversial topic is one that has differing opinions and can provoke debate.

What is a claim in argumentative writing?

Back

A claim is a statement that asserts a belief or position that the writer supports with evidence.

What is a counter-claim?

Back

A counter-claim is the presentation of an opposing position to the writer's argument.

What is evidence in argumentative writing?

Back

Evidence consists of facts, statistics, or examples that support the writer's claims.
